"What is the current size and growth rate of the Patient Handling Equipment Market?

The Patient Handling Equipment Market size is estimated to reach over USD 17,705.34 Million by 2035 from a value of USD 11,396.79 Million in 2024 and is projected to grow by USD 11,843.73 Million in 2026, growing at a CAGR of 6.10% from 2026 to 2035.

Regional Highlights of Patient Handling Equipment Market:

  • North America:


    This region is projected to maintain a significant market share, primarily driven by a robust healthcare infrastructure, high adoption of advanced technologies, and stringent regulatory frameworks promoting patient and caregiver safety. Key cities like New York, Los Angeles, and Toronto are hubs for medical innovation and expenditure. The region is expected to grow at a CAGR of approximately 6.0% during the forecast period.

  • Europe:


    Europe represents a strong market, fueled by its rapidly aging population, well-established healthcare systems, and increasing awareness regarding ergonomic patient handling. Leading countries such as Germany, the UK, and France are major contributors due to high healthcare spending and a focus on quality patient care. The region is anticipated to exhibit a CAGR of around 5.8%.

  • Asia Pacific:


    This region is poised for the fastest growth, propelled by expanding healthcare infrastructure, rising disposable incomes, and a large patient pool. Emerging economies like China, India, and Japan are investing heavily in modernizing their healthcare facilities and improving patient care standards. This region is estimated to grow at a CAGR of approximately 6.5%.

Frequently Asked Questions:

  • Que:


    What is patient handling equipment?


    Ans:


    Patient handling equipment refers to devices designed to safely lift, transfer, or reposition patients, minimizing physical strain on both patients and caregivers.

  • Que:


    Why is patient handling equipment important in healthcare?


    Ans:


    It is crucial for preventing musculoskeletal injuries to healthcare workers, enhancing patient safety, and improving the efficiency of patient care.
